Output 52dbbcd8bf31ee2f4eec4216c50f8cbdcbd33cc1b87d5a54d1c433442cea1bb5:0

value
14982508
script pubkey
OP_0 OP_PUSHBYTES_20 bf7ed095b907f717223a0b5f8353010ed190fc93
address
bc1qhaldp9deqlm3wg36pd0cx5cppmgeplynpq85ju
transaction
52dbbcd8bf31ee2f4eec4216c50f8cbdcbd33cc1b87d5a54d1c433442cea1bb5
confirmations
112377
spent
true